Lines Matching refs:xencons_info

35 struct xencons_info {  struct
53 static struct xencons_info *vtermno_to_xencons(int vtermno) in vtermno_to_xencons() argument
55 struct xencons_info *entry, *n, *ret = NULL; in vtermno_to_xencons()
75 static inline void notify_daemon(struct xencons_info *cons) in notify_daemon()
81 static int __write_console(struct xencons_info *xencons, in __write_console()
111 struct xencons_info *cons = vtermno_to_xencons(vtermno); in domU_write_console()
142 struct xencons_info *xencons = vtermno_to_xencons(vtermno); in domU_read_console()
227 struct xencons_info *info; in xen_hvm_console_init()
234 info = kzalloc(sizeof(struct xencons_info), GFP_KERNEL); in xen_hvm_console_init()
271 static int xencons_info_pv_init(struct xencons_info *info, int vtermno) in xencons_info_pv_init()
285 struct xencons_info *info; in xen_pv_console_init()
295 info = kzalloc(sizeof(struct xencons_info), GFP_KERNEL); in xen_pv_console_init()
311 struct xencons_info *info; in xen_initial_domain_console_init()
318 info = kzalloc(sizeof(struct xencons_info), GFP_KERNEL); in xen_initial_domain_console_init()
333 static void xen_console_update_evtchn(struct xencons_info *info) in xen_console_update_evtchn()
348 struct xencons_info *info = vtermno_to_xencons(HVC_COOKIE); in xen_console_resume()
357 static void xencons_disconnect_backend(struct xencons_info *info) in xencons_disconnect_backend()
373 static void xencons_free(struct xencons_info *info) in xencons_free()
381 static int xen_console_remove(struct xencons_info *info) in xen_console_remove()
403 struct xencons_info *info) in xencons_connect_backend()
466 struct xencons_info *info; in xencons_probe()
472 info = kzalloc(sizeof(struct xencons_info), GFP_KERNEL); in xencons_probe()
502 struct xencons_info *info = dev_get_drvdata(&dev->dev); in xencons_resume()
556 struct xencons_info *info; in xen_hvc_init()
644 static struct xencons_info xenboot; in xenboot_console_setup()